I had a drive of my Friend's 710 today with a Max Power MX12S3 modified by Fantini. I must say i was very impressed. Awesome power all through the range. Temps were around 220-230 (85 degree day) and it made around 6 minutes run time. With the performance i saw, and the fact that it is Nova based, i'd definately consider one.
